Summary: Reflections on the spiritual value of art
Review: This is a beautiful little book, actually a compil-
ation of lectures delivered at musical events and
openings. With references to the ancient philosophers,
it reminds us of the moral and spiritual force
of genuine "seeing" and "hearing." A learned series
of essays, but written in an accessible, and poetic, way.

Summary: A Sampler in Aesthetics
Review: This is a collection of brief speeches given the late Josef Pieper, one of the most popular Thomist philosophers of the last century. The topics addressed include work and leisure, music, seeing, sculpture, celebration, and contemplation.

The book's title is taken from St. Augustine's remark that "only he who loves can sing," and if there is an underlying theme to these occasional pieces it is that art and love, aesthetics and spirituality, cannot be divorced. A sample quote: "Contemplation is visual perception prompted by loving acceptance."

Due to their brevity, these essays can only be suggestive. But perhaps they may whet the reader's appetite for more substantial portions of Pieper's thoughtful yet accessible philosophizing.
